Dramatic Duel Between STVV and RWDM: Last-Minute Goals and Surprise Victory

2023-10-27 20:41:00

The duel between STVV and RWDM this Friday will have disappointed everyone, even those who expected nothing. But the last 10 minutes were exceptional.

STVV and RWDM are really not on good terms. The Coalisés twice lost points in the final seconds, while the Canaries have just conceded 8 goals in two games.

So… no one wants to lose this meeting and it shows. The risks taken are minimal between the Limburgers who play with the handbrake in possession of the ball and the Brussels residents who attack with three, four at most. Besides, the two goalkeepers have nothing to eat while we are bored in the sparse stands of Stayen. Everyone is practically relieved to see the referee whistle for the break.

After half-time and a change to the Canary side, everything changes! Hmm…. sorry for this two-euro joke, because nothing better happens than in the first act. The goalkeepers only warm their gloves on crosses, and we are completely bored.

At least until the last 10 minutes dawned. A slightly bizarre situation in the rectangle pushes the referee to consult the VAR. Segova, involuntarily, makes a volleyball-style headline. The referee whistles a penalty, and Koita converts it (80′, 1-0).

This goal frees the Canaries who create a superb opportunity in the process, but Defourny saves the furniture. But where the RWDM lost points in stoppage time in other weeks, this time the scenario is different. A cross from the right deflected by Godeau arrives at the feet of Gueye who plays his defender (90’+4, 1-1).

But remember: the other weeks, the stoppages in play were negative for the RWDM. Well, it’s the case again this week: Koita, in the last seconds, crosses to the far post and Hashioka’s angry header. STVV miraculously takes three more points than its opponent.
